A 32-year-old man from Nairobi has emotionally opened up about his troubled marriage and the heartbreak he says he has endured over the years.

Speaking in an exclusive interview with NGBREAKINGNEWS, Aggrey Mokaya said he has been married for seven years, but only experienced peace during the first three.
According to the father of one, the last four years have been marked by heartache, physical and emotional abuse, leaving him feeling hopeless and at times struggling with the desire to continue living.

How did Aggrey meet his wife?
The father of one said he met his wife while working at a pool table in the Baba Dogo area, where she was selling porridge.
He explained that, at first, he was not interested in pursuing a relationship because he believed she was already married.
“I met my wife in the area where I lived. I used to see her around, but I wasn’t that interested in her because of the way she carried herself. I thought she was someone’s wife. She was hawking porridge and I was working at a pool table. With time, we got to know each other,” he shared.
After six months, the two became a couple, and she frequently visited Aggrey at his home as their relationship blossomed.
They eventually decided to move in together and began living as husband and wife by mutual agreement.
A few months later, the woman became pregnant just as the coronavirus pandemic hit the country. Aggrey said the pregnancy brought them joy, as they were excited about starting a family together.

As time passed, they welcomed their son, while Aggrey worked as a matatu tout to provide for his wife and child.
“Whenever we faced challenges during those first three years, I believed they were the normal ups and downs that come with marriage. I always thought we would apologise, talk things through and move on. Everything would be okay,” Aggrey recalled.
However, he claimed the relationship took a turn during their fourth year together, when his wife allegedly began questioning his whereabouts more frequently.
When did marital problems begin between Aggrey and his wife?
He explained that his wife claimed she had a talent that whatever dream she had was the truth, and during that period she dreamed that Aggrey was seeing someone else.
“She told me that she slept and she dreamt that when I close work for the day, there is somewhere I always go to before coming home,” he said.
According to Aggrey, his work sometimes required him to stay out until 9 pm, depending on traffic, the availability of passengers and other work-related factors.

He alleged that this became a major source of conflict, with his wife accusing him of being unfaithful.
“I tried explaining to her the nature of my work, but she could not understand. She kept saying she had dreamt that I was seeing another woman, which was not true. I even asked her how I could have another woman when every shilling I earned came home, but she insisted,” he said.
Aggrey also recounted several occasions when, he claimed, his wife caused scenes that attracted the attention of neighbours. He further alleged that she physically assaulted him using various household items.
“At one point, she grabbed a one-litre bottle full of water and hit me with it. I think all the fighting and arguing deeply affected and traumatised my son. Right now, he hates being anywhere people are arguing,” he said.
The father of one said the final straw came when they recently got into a physical confrontation that was captured on video.
According to Aggrey, the two were fighting over custody of their six-year-old son, with each parent wanting the child to remain with them.

During the altercation, which showed their son crying and pleading to stay with his father, Aggrey sustained injuries to his cheeks, with visible scratch marks that he claimed were caused by his wife’s fingernails.
The father of one said he has now reached a breaking point, explaining that the emotional pain has left him feeling overwhelmed.
He revealed that he carries a handwritten letter addressed to his son and the world wherever he goes, saying he wrote it in case anything ever happens to him, a reflection of the deep emotional toll he says the marriage has taken on his life.
